description <p>(<b>A-C</b>) Dually labeled <i>D. discoideum</i> Ax2 or Δ<i>gnbp</i> producing calnexin (CnxA)-GFP (pAW016) and P4C-mCherry (pWS032) was treated with LAI-1 (10 µM, 1 h), or DMSO (solvent control), infected (MOI 5, 4 h) with mCerulean-producing <i>L. pneumophila</i> JR32 (pNP99), fixed and analyzed by confocal microscopy. Scale bars, 3 µm. (<b>D-G</b>) <i>D. discoideum</i> Ax2 or Δ<i>gnbp</i> producing CnxA-mCherry (pAW012) or P4C-mCherry (pWS032) was infected (MOI 5) for (<b>D</b>, <b>E</b>) 4 h or (<b>F</b>, <b>G</b>) 2-20 h with GFP-producing <i>L. pneumophila</i> JR32 harboring pMF16 (P<sub><i>6SRNA</i></sub>-<i>lqsA</i>) or pMF17 (P<sub><i>6SRNA</i></sub>-<i>lqsA</i><sup>K258A</sup>), fixed and analyzed by confocal microscopy. Scale bars, 3 µm. The area of LCVs positive for (<b>E</b>, <b>F</b>) CnxA or (<b>E</b>, <b>G</b>) P4C was quantified using ImageJ software. Data shown are means and standard deviations of biological triplicates (Student’s t-test; *, <i>p</i> ≤ 0.05; **, <i>p</i> ≤ 0.01; ***, <i>p</i> ≤ 0.001).</p>
